Tomlinson, Charles. Amusements in chess (1845).
I. Sketches of the history, antiquities, and curiosities of the game; II. Easy lessons in chess, a selection of games, illustrative of the various openings, analyzed and explained, for the use of young players; III. A selection of chess problems, or, ends of games won by brilliant and scientific moves. With some woodcuts and many diagrams. IX, pp. 3 - 352. The edition contains a history of chess, a collection of endgames, a contribution on Kempelen's chess machine and the Rösselsprung. London, Parker, 1845. L/N 4540; van der Linde II, 295. Schmid, p. 332. Kieler Schachkatalog 1841.
Condition: VG. Slight wear. Publishers original blue cloth.
